Chris Elmore MP is calling on local residents living within his Ogmore constituency to complete his “Ogmore Opinions” survey over the summer months to inform his campaign work on key local and national issues.
Over the summer Parliamentary recess, Chris is very keen to hear local residents’ views on a number of the key issues he has campaigned on over recent months and years. While also providing an opportunity for constituents to raise other issues with him, Chris is asking for input on the following issues:

Digital inclusion (broadband connectivity, mobile phone coverage and TV signal)
Community funding
Social media and its impact on mental health
Crime and community safety
Tackling online and telephone scams
Infrastructure funding (of both national and local in scope)
Chris intends to feed back the results of the survey to constituents following the summer Parliamentary recess and will be analysing the results over the summer months to help inform and refine his campaigning work in the weeks and months ahead.
